Geometry manual written by the outstanding Soviet teacher and "legislator" of school mathematics A.P. Kiselev. The main goal the author set for himself was to achieve students' understanding of the subject. His textbooks provided a high level of mathematical training for several generations of citizens of our country. The peculiarity of the presentation of the material consists in the accuracy of concepts, simple reasoning and concise presentation. Thanks to this, learning is given easily and brings a good result. The book consists of two parts. This first part reveals the concepts of the plane, straight line, circle, angle. Tells about the types of triangles, their properties and signs of equality. Helps to learn to determine the length of the circle, measure the area of geometric figures. Contains practical exercises and problems with an explanation of the solution. The publication is intended for secondary school students who want to improve their knowledge of geometry, practicing teachers, and all those interested in mathematics.
